1.0 INSTALLATION

Setra’s Model 328 is a small, local display designed for installation in high density modular block
gas sticks and panels. It can be used with voltage output and current output transducers using
15 Pin and 9 Pin D-Sub connectors. Consult Table 2, the Configurable Part Number Chart on
page 3, to determine the configuration that is supplied. For setting optimum viewing angle, the
328 display housing can rotate 360

º

degrees. A built-in positive stop limits the rotation of the

front portion to a maximum of 360

º

degrees. If resistance is encountered when trying to rotate

in one direction, rotate in the opposite direction.

2.0 ELECTRICAL CONNECTIONS

The 328 can be supplied with either a 15 Pin high-density or 9 Pin D-Sub connector to the input
transducer and to the power supply. Confirm the electrical connection supplied, and refer to the
appropriate column below for proper connections.

2.3 EMC Certification

This product complies with EMC Directive 2004/108/EC per EN61326-1 Electrical Equipment
for Measurement, Control and Laboratory use – EMC Requirements. In order to meet the EMC
requirements, the following conditions must be followed during installation:

1. Shielded cable must be used, and the shield must be tied to earth ground (not power

supply ground) on at least one end of the cable shield/drain wire. The shield must be
maintained all the way from sensor to the power supply.

2. If unshielded cable is used, an earth grounded metal conduit fitting can be used to

replace the shielded cable.
